    Professional Background

    David Farber is a distinguished partner in the FDA/Life Sciences Practice at King & Spalding, where he leverages his extensive knowledge of pharmaceutical coverage, coding, and reimbursement issues. With a prominent career in healthcare lobbying, David has represented a diverse array of healthcare manufacturers and service providers, earning widespread recognition in the industry. His expertise is particularly noted in the area of Medicare Secondary Payer (MSP) issues, where he has made a significant impact as one of the principal drafters of the SMART Act. This landmark legislation, enacted for the first time in 30 years, revised the MSP statute, demonstrating David’s commitment to advancing healthcare legislation that benefits stakeholders across the sector.

    As a partner at King & Spalding, David has been involved in pivotal matters that highlight his effectiveness as a lobbyist and legal advocate. His successful lobbying efforts to enact the SMART Act (H.R. 1063, 112th Congress) mark a significant achievement in his career, showcasing his capability to influence healthcare policy at a national level. Furthermore, his legal prowess was evident when he defended a group of third-party administrators in False Claims Act litigation, underlining his strong litigation skills.

    David’s advocacy extends to working with the Center for Medicare and Medicaid Services (CMS), where he successfully reversed an Agency rejection of coverage determination, further solidifying his standing as a knowledgeable strategist in healthcare reimbursement intricacies.

    Achievements

    David's career is marked by numerous achievements that highlight both his advocacy skills and his dedication to improving healthcare legislation. Some notable milestones include:

    • Drafting the SMART Act: As a principal drafter, David played a crucial role in revising the Medicare Secondary Payer statute, helping to modernize a law that had remained unchanged for three decades. This act has had a lasting impact on how Medicare interacts with other insurance payers, streamlining processes and benefitting healthcare providers and beneficiaries alike.
    • Successful Lobbying Efforts: David’s ability to navigate the complexities of healthcare policy is exemplified by his successful lobbying efforts that led to the enactment of the SMART Act and its implementation. His strategic vision and negotiation capabilities were key to advancing this critical piece of legislation.
    • Advocacy and Representation: By effectively advocating for healthcare providers before CMS, David has demonstrated his commitment to ensuring their needs and interests are represented. His ability to reverse coverage determination rejections reflects his strategic approach and deep understanding of healthcare payer systems.
